    Expert COVER LETTERS with ChatGPT: the Definitive Guide (with Examples & Prompts)

    blog thumbnail

    Introduction

    Three weeks ago, I embarked on a challenge: to explore whether ChatGPT could help write expert-level cover letters. As a careers consultant at Cambridge University, I coach clients in crafting compelling cover letters. Initially, I felt optimistic. But after three weeks and 137 prompts, my confidence was put to the test.

    Initial Assessment

    To gauge ChatGPT's capabilities, I began with a straightforward prompt for a business analyst role at the British Museum, assessing the output as a baseline. The cover letter started well, stating, "I'm writing to express my strong interest in the position of business analyst at the British Museum as advertised on LinkedIn." However, the first paragraph, while decent, was quite generic and lacked the intriguing details that captivate recruiters.

    In the second paragraph, ChatGPT mentioned skills such as data analytics and project management, which weren't highlighted in the actual job description. This revelation suggested that ChatGPT might be web-scraping and using frequently matched skills across business analyst roles instead of processing the specific job description I provided. Ultimately, the letter came across as too lengthy without the essential skills emphasized, earning a score of about 4 out of 10 for a polished submission.

    Improving the Process

    Determined to push ChatGPT toward higher-quality outputs, I utilized recommended prompts from GitHub, yet they did not yield the expert-level results I sought. Most inputs were singularly focused and did not effectively engage with the job description. So I had an epiphany: if ChatGPT wouldn’t adapt to the job description, I would adapt the job description for it.

    Crafting Specific Prompts

    First, I delved into what constitutes an expert-level cover letter:

    1. Paragraph One: A compelling hook about the organization, a connection to my own work, and a mention of the top relevant skills from the job description.
    2. Paragraphs Two and Three: A specific focus on the leading skills mentioned in the job description.
    3. Closing: A succinct wrap-up that reinforces my willingness to contribute.

    Using this structure, I developed precise prompts that maintained this breakdown while aiming for tailored outputs aligned with the specific application.

    Outcomes and Refinements

    When I fed ChatGPT the refined prompts, the output began to show appreciation for the British Museum and highlighted organizational skills early, plus it structured the paragraphs neatly. There were clear mentions of top skills, but still, obscure examples were used rather than real-life achievements. While it provided a solid framework for editing, the cover letter still required personal touches to lift it to a ready-to-submit level, which I rated 5 out of 10.

    After 137 iterations, I learned that while ChatGPT excels at generating templates and initial drafts, the responses reflected a pattern-matching tool that requires human intervention for refinement.

    FAQ

    Q1: Can ChatGPT write expert-level cover letters?
    A1: While ChatGPT can generate drafts and templates for cover letters, it often requires refinement and personal examples to achieve an expert level.

    Q2: What's the best way to use ChatGPT for cover letters?
    A2: Use structured prompts that reflect the job description and your qualifications, then edit the output by including personal experiences and specific accomplishments.

    Q3: How can I improve my cover letter writing skills?
    A3: Analyze strong examples, adopt effective prompt structures, and practice contrasting your drafts against job descriptions to hone your writing skills.

    Q4: Is ChatGPT suitable for final submissions?
    A4: It's not ideal for ready-to-submit cover letters. It’s best used as a starting point from which you can manually enhance the content before submitting it.
